×

DECENTRALIZED TRANSACTION COMMIT PROTOCOL

  • US 20170177698A1
  • Filed: 12/21/2015
  • Published: 06/22/2017
  • Est. Priority Date: 12/21/2015
  • Status: Active Grant
First Claim
Patent Images

1. A method, implemented at least in part by a first database system node comprising a processing unit and memory, the first database system node being in communication with at least a second and a third database system nodes, for facilitating database transaction processing within a database environment, the method comprising, at the first database system node:

  • receiving a request to commit a first database transaction;

    sending a request to the second database system node to precommit the first database transaction;

    determining a synchronized transaction token;

    assigning, based at least in part on the synchronized transaction token, a first transaction token to the first database transaction;

    sending the first transaction token to the second database system node;

    committing the first database transaction;

    acknowledging the commit of the first database transaction to a database client;

    receiving a request from the third database system node to precommit a second database transaction; and

    adding, to a precommit log, a precommit log entry.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×